Barley news Australia: ABB’s barley regulation system abandoned by parliament

The South Australian parliament has passed legislation abandoning the single desk system operated solely by ABB Grain Export Ltd which has long regulated the export of barley, The Age reported March 28.

"The new act allows growers to deliver bulk barley to the exporter of their choice," said state Agriculture Minister Rory McEwen.

Mr McEwen said an independent regulator, the Essential Services Commission of South Australia, would administer the scheme over the next three years.

"The future of the barley single desk has been a complex and long-standing issue and it's been pleasing to see the leadership shown by the industry in recommending these changes," the minister said.
